“David Gould reflects on Grenoble’s season and their fight for survival in the French championship”

Penultimate of the Southern conference of the French championship, the Centaurs will play their skin on the final day. A look back at this season with David Gould, Canadian coach from Grenoble.

For the Centaurs, there was a before and after this season. To start the year, Grenoble took rouste on rouste. First in Nice against the Dolphins (36-3) then in Toulouse against the Bears (40-2). As the 2023 financial year got off to a bad start, the Centaurs called David Gould for help. Present on the sidelines from 2017 to 2021, the Canadian coach had returned to live in Grenoble, his city of hearts, and that of his family. The club did not miss the opportunity to find its technician, recruited by an online platform six years ago. “I had never planned to cross the Atlantic. It’s a pretty crazy story, but I don’t regret it at all! smiles the one who also passed through Nice.

Progress over the year

After the return of its North American technician, Grenoble is moving forward again. Little by little, the Centaurs are getting closer to victory. During the 4e day, they push the Catalan Grizzlys of Perpignan to their limits (26-28), before failing to overthrow Toulouse (14-16). “Even if we didn’t win, I felt that something clicked. Then we beat Aix and Nice, it did us a lot of good. This year, we saw that we could compete with most teams. All season, David Gould had to deal with a shortened squad: “We had 42 guys at the start. But with the injuries etc, we often found ourselves at 26, 27), it’s very complicated to develop your game in these conditions”.

The maintenance at the end?

Thanks to its two victories gleaned at the end of the season, Grenoble offers a slight lead over the red lantern, the Argonautes of Aix. Enough to avoid relegation? “Certainly, the pressure is above all on Aix, who absolutely must win. It will be a distance duel, everything will be decided on this last day. It’s an end-of-season scenario worthy of a movie! “. In the cave of the Catalan Grizzlys of Perpignan, clinging to their 3e qualifying place for the play-offs, the match will necessarily be disputed. “It’s a very well-coached team. », salute David Gould. “The fact that we came so close to beating them in the first leg will give us motivation. In addition to the challenge of course…”
